Book contract
Terry Moore has signed a contract with publisher Fairmont Press to author a book due out in 2010 titled “A Guide to US Climate Change Regulation”. The book will offer a plain english explanation of federal policies such as EPA Mandatory Greenhouse Gas Reporting, the EPA Proposed rule for GHG Tailoring and (should the Boxer-Kerry bill pass the Senate) federal cap-and-trade legislation as it is enacted.
